Before applying the labels, wipe the surface of the vehicle with a clean, dry cloth to remove any dust or oils.

First apply the inside edge of a label to the back end of the vehicle. Next, apply the outside edge of the label to the side of the vehicle. Then, smooth the center of the label. (The edges will overlap slightly.)

For best results, avoid repositioning a label once it has been applied to the vehicle.
